Gas-phase Inorganic Chemistry: How is it Relevant to Condensed-phase Inorganic Chemistry?

Similarities in the methodologies of laser ablation Fourier-transform ion cyclotron resonance mass spectrometry and condensed-phase studies are shown. The reactions of bare gas-phase cations with molecules such as benzenethiol, benzene and sulfur are used to show similarities and differences with condensed-phase systems. The similarity of the gas-phase chemistry of europium Eu<sup>+</sup> with that of the Group II ions Ca<sup>+</sup>, Sr<sup>+</sup> and Ba<sup>+</sup> is highlighted. Copper cyanide anions and cations are used to indicate coordination chemistry in the gas phase. Examples are given to show how the observation of gas-phase ions, particularly the metal-sulfide cluster anions has the potential of guiding condensed-phase syntheses.
